Evgeniya Vaskova is a scholar working on Molecular Biology, Surgery and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Evgeniya Vaskova has authored 15 papers receiving a total of 414 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 4 papers in Surgery and 3 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Evgeniya Vaskova's work include Extracellular vesicles in disease (4 papers), RNA Interference and Gene Delivery (3 papers) and Fuel Cells and Related Materials (3 papers). Evgeniya Vaskova is often cited by papers focused on Extracellular vesicles in disease (4 papers), RNA Interference and Gene Delivery (3 papers) and Fuel Cells and Related Materials (3 papers). Evgeniya Vaskova collaborates with scholars based in United States, Russia and China. Evgeniya Vaskova's co-authors include Phillip C. Yang, Gentaro Ikeda, Yuko Tada, Michelle Santoso, Ji‐Hye Jung, Connor O’Brien, Elizabeth S. Egan, Jiangbin Ye, Albert M. Li and Christine Wahlquist and has published in prestigious journals such as Circulation, Journal of the American College of Cardiology and PLoS ONE.
